Karrion Kross Hopes Multi-Time AEW Champion Returns To WWE One Day
WWE superstar Karrion Kross recently appeared on Battleground Podcast to talk about his former gimmick and WrestleMania promo among other things. During the conversation, the hosts asked Kross about AEW World Champion Jon Moxley.

'Jon's a former WWE champion,' he said. 'He's competed and performed with some of the best people in the world. Seth Rollins, Roman Reigns, The Shield. I didn't know him. I put out a promo attempting to pique intrigue to see if that's a match people wanted. They wanted it. He didn't know me. I didn't know him.'
Karrion Kross reveals Jon Moxley complimented his work
'I really wanted to work with him as soon as I found out that he wasn't signed, and he showed up. We didn't know each other. We worked, and then as soon as we got backstage, it feels weird talking about somebody else giving you compliments about your work. It is. But he was very complimentary, and that's where that conversation began and not to stir the pot, but I just, I want Jon to be happy wherever he is.
'I do hope one day. I do hope one day that he does come back to WWE because I think it would be insane. I think it would be insane, and I would love to compete with him here. I would love to compete with him here so we can finish what we started. That's what I will say.' [H/T Fightful]

Though the pair didn't meet in a WWE ring, Karrion Kross and Jon Moxley did cross paths at FSW Natural Born Killers on July 5, 2019, a month after Moxley's AEW in-ring debut against Joey Janela at the promotion's inaugural Fyter Fest event.

While a handful of professional wrestlers have successfully transitioned into the world of politics, the path is not a common one. The most prominent success story is Jesse "The Body" Ventura, who was elected Governor of Minnesota in 1998, serving one full term. Others have tried, with former WWE CEO Linda McMahon making two expensive but unsuccessful runs for a U.S. Senate seat before serving as the Administrator of the Small Business Administration. While Dwayne "The Rock" Johnson has been the subject of serious polling and discussion for a potential presidential run, he has never officially entered a race. Cena stars alongside Idris Elba and Priyanka Chopra Jonas in the action-comedy Heads of State, which premiered on Amazon Prime Video on July 2, 2025. The film, directed by Nobody's Ilya Naishuller, features a plot reminiscent of classic buddy-action movies. Cena plays Will Derringer, a former action movie star who has become the President of the United States. He and the British Prime Minister, Sam Clarke (Elba), have a public rivalry but are forced to go on the run together after a conspiracy leaves them stranded and hunted. They must rely on each other and a brilliant MI6 agent (Chopra Jonas) to survive and unravel a plot that threatens the entire world. Dwayne 'The Rock' Johnson has thanked Jelly Roll for helping him through a "very hard" time. The WWE legend turned Hollywood megastar has shared a video of the moment he finally met and hugged the Only hitmaker, whose song "moved" him around 2017 when he was "struggling" with his mental health. Alongside a video of the pair hugging and saying they loved each other, The Rock wrote: "A brotherly hug almost 10 years in the making... "Several years ago (roughly 2017) I was going through a very hard thing at the time, I was struggling. "My mental wellness turned into my mental hellness. Many of you know the drill, you put on 'the face,' show up to work, smile and get through it. "Perhaps not the healthiest thing to do, but it's what I was used to doing at the time. "Then a song came on through my headphones one morning on a random shuffle playlist. 'Only' from Jelly Roll. The lyrics rocked me. Hard core." In the emotional song, Jelly - who is also a huge WWE fan - sings: "What if the darkness inside of me has finally taken my soul?/What if the angels in heaven were sent to take me home? "Would they fight through the demons that I have in my life?/Lord, I'm believing eventually see the light." The Fast and Furious actor recalled how he was moved "so much" that he got in touch with the singer at the time, and shared how "this song of yours is helping me through some stuff I'm dealing with". and that he "just called to say thank you". He continued: "Our bond was born." When the pair finally met in person recently, Dwayne gave Jelly a gift which he admitted might seem "insignificant to the world", but would mean a lot to Jelly. He gave the singer an old postcard of the former Alamo Plaza motel in South Nashville, where Jelly is from. Dwayne explained: "When I was 15yrs I was forced (family was evicted) to leave Hawaii and make it to Nashville to live with my dad. "That didn't work out so I wound up living with a stranger in this little spot on Murfreesboro Road that has since been torn down and no longer there. "Downtown Bruno was that stranger's name and to this day, he's one of my best and most special friends. Just like Jelly. A very special friend." In the Instagram video, Jelly admitted that the postcard - which was signed by The Rock - "is real old school Nashville history". Dwayne added in the caption: "Every once in a while we all get sliced up by life, but it's amazing to see what kind of blessings and people that God and the universe will put in our lives to help us heal through our pain."
